| AddRef() | FShaderMapResource | |
| ArePlatformsCompatible(EShaderPlatform CurrentPlatform, EShaderPlatform TargetPlatform) | FShaderMapResource | static |
| BeginCreateAllShaders() | FShaderMapResource | |
| bEntireShaderMapPreloaded | FShaderMapResource_SharedCode | |
| ChangeFeatureLevel(ERHIFeatureLevel::Type NewFeatureLevel) | FRenderResource | static |
| ContainsAtLeastOneRHIShaderCreated() const | FShaderMapResource | inline |
| CreateRHIBuffer(FRHICommandListBase &RHICmdList, T &InOutResourceObject, uint32 ResourceCount, EBufferUsageFlags InBufferUsageFlags, const TCHAR *InDebugName) | FRenderResource | inlineprotected |
| CreateRHIShaderOrCrash(int32 ShaderIndex, bool bRequired) override | FShaderMapResource_SharedCode | virtual |
| EInitPhase enum name | FRenderResource | |
| FRenderResource() | FRenderResource | |
| FRenderResource(ERHIFeatureLevel::Type InFeatureLevel) | FRenderResource | |
| FRenderResource(const FRenderResource &) | FRenderResource | |
| FRenderResource(FRenderResource &&) | FRenderResource | |
| FShaderMapResource(EShaderPlatform InPlatform, int32 NumShaders) | FShaderMapResource | explicitprotected |
| FShaderMapResource_SharedCode(class FShaderLibraryInstance *InLibraryInstance, int32 InShaderMapIndex) | FShaderMapResource_SharedCode | |
| GetAllocatedSize() const | FShaderMapResource | inlineprotected |
| GetFeatureLevel() const | FRenderResource | inlineprotected |
| GetFriendlyName() const override | FShaderMapResource_SharedCode | virtual |
| GetGroupIndexForShader(int32 ShaderIndex) const override | FShaderMapResource_SharedCode | virtual |
| GetImmediateCommandList() | FRenderResource | protectedstatic |
| GetInitPhase() const | FRenderResource | inline |
| GetLibraryId() const override | FShaderMapResource_SharedCode | virtual |
| GetLibraryShaderIndex(int32 ShaderIndex) const override | FShaderMapResource_SharedCode | virtual |
| GetListIndex() const | FRenderResource | inline |
| GetNumRefs() const | FShaderMapResource | inline |
| GetNumShaders() const | FShaderMapResource | inline |
| GetOwnerName() const | FRenderResource | inline |
| GetPlatform() const | FShaderMapResource | inline |
| GetResourceName() const | FRenderResource | inline |
| GetShader(int32 ShaderIndex, bool bRequired=true) | FShaderMapResource | inline |
| GetShaderHash(int32 ShaderIndex) override | FShaderMapResource_SharedCode | virtual |
| GetShaderMapHash() const override | FShaderMapResource_SharedCode | virtual |
| GetShaderSizeBytes(int32 ShaderIndex) const override | FShaderMapResource_SharedCode | virtual |
| GetSizeBytes() const override | FShaderMapResource_SharedCode | inlinevirtual |
| HasShader(int32 ShaderIndex) const | FShaderMapResource | inline |
| HasValidFeatureLevel() const | FRenderResource | inlineprotected |
| InitPreRHIResources() | FRenderResource | static |
| InitResource(FRHICommandListBase &RHICmdList) | FRenderResource | virtual |
| InitRHI(FRHICommandListBase &RHICmdList) | FRenderResource | inlinevirtual |
| IsInitialized() const | FRenderResource | inline |
| IsValidShaderIndex(int32 ShaderIndex) const | FShaderMapResource | inline |
| LibraryInstance | FShaderMapResource_SharedCode | |
| operator=(const FRenderResource &Other) | FRenderResource | |
| operator=(FRenderResource &&Other) | FRenderResource | |
| PreloadShader(int32 ShaderIndex, FGraphEventArray &OutCompletionEvents) override | FShaderMapResource_SharedCode | virtual |
| PreloadShaderMap(FGraphEventArray &OutCompletionEvents) override | FShaderMapResource_SharedCode | virtual |
| Release() | FShaderMapResource | |
| ReleasePreloadedShaderCode(int32 ShaderIndex) override | FShaderMapResource_SharedCode | virtual |
| ReleaseResource() override | FShaderMapResource_SharedCode | inlinevirtual |
| ReleaseRHI() override | FShaderMapResource_SharedCode | virtual |
| ReleaseRHIForAllResources() | FRenderResource | static |
| ReleaseShaders() | FShaderMapResource | protected |
| ResourceState | FRenderResource | |
| SetFeatureLevel(const FStaticFeatureLevel InFeatureLevel) | FRenderResource | inlineprotected |
| SetInitPhase(EInitPhase InInitPhase) | FRenderResource | inlineprotected |
| SetOwnerName(FName InOwnerName) | FRenderResource | inline |
| SetResourceName(FName InResourceName) | FRenderResource | inline |
| SetScopeName(FName Name) | FRenderResource | static |
| ShaderMapIndex | FShaderMapResource_SharedCode | |
| TryRelease() override | FShaderMapResource_SharedCode | virtual |
| UpdateRHI(FRHICommandListBase &RHICmdList) | FRenderResource | |
| ~FDeferredCleanupInterface() | FDeferredCleanupInterface | inlinevirtual |
| ~FRenderResource() | FRenderResource | virtual |
| ~FShaderMapResource() | FShaderMapResource | protectedvirtual |
| ~FShaderMapResource_SharedCode() | FShaderMapResource_SharedCode | virtual |